Tyranobuilder is straight up abandonware. From personal experience: unless it's a lineal/kinetic novel you WILL need to code and there's 0 documentation on it. It doesnt allow for much customization UI wise and when you do try to modify it you will encounter program bugs that have not been fixed and likely NEVER WILL. It is a shame bc you can easily add live2D stuff and mini games made in frazer but all that goes to the trash when the export for anything but windows just DOESN't work and changing the UI is almost impossible. I would say it's good for a MICRO game at best but if you have more than one ending or need routes you are doomed. The documentation is so poorly done it's almost a joke and the old documentation is just GONE, the only good thing are a few tutorials in spanish from several years ago in trash quality. From the bottom of my heart: do not use tyranobuilder. For all the good things it may have the headache it will give you is simply not worth it
